My favourite i like to cook is, 500gms beef mince cooked brown and drain fat off, add chopped onion and an oxo cube and cook stirring on gentle heat till onion is cooked. I then add shredded carrot, a half tin of peas, chopped baked fresh honey roast parsnips, chopped small fried red pepper and a tin of Branston baked beans. Add 600ml beef stock gravy and gently bring to boil and simmer. I then add salt to season and taste as it cooks. Add creamy mash over top in the dish with a nice coating of extra mature cheese and cook for 25min fan oven 180 middle shelf. I would also use the same ingredients without the topping etc for another meal but add chunks of sweet potato to it and serve up in a homemade batter pud cooked in an 8-inch deep round tin which I'm very good at.
